What
is your definition of Integrated Pest Management (IPM)? |
|
We
use OPM - Organic Pest Management - the natural form of IPM. We provide
soil testing, use of amendments/fertilizers, pruning and natural weed
control (all cultural practices) before the use of organic pesticides
(such as beneficial insect release, Bt followed by pesticides made
with organic derivatives) |
|
Is pest management performed on a specific schedule? |
|
Spring
and late spring applications of corn gluten to reduce crab grass (weeds).
Summer releases of nematodes to control various grubs (lawn care)
and black vine weeval (landscape care). |
|
How
are pest problems identified? |
|
We
use a 30X scope to check the emergence of hemlock wooly aldegids from
the cotton white egg satches and use various Delta Wing Traps (sticky
traps) as well as various colored sticky traps (white, blue, red and
yellow) to catch and hold insects for identification. |
|
What practices
do you use to prevent and/or control pests? |
|
We
use temperature Degree Day's (TDD) to monitor insect incubation/emergence. |

What
are the top 10 pesticides you use/sell/recommend? |
|
Corn
gluten, Bt, nematodes, pyrethrum,
rotenone, vegetable based horticultural oil, horticultural soaps,
garlic, hot pepper and diatomaceous earth. |
|
If pesticides are used, how much are used per year of each? |
|
Spot treatments
by hand operated equipment to reduce drift. All pesticides used are
non chemical and 100% organic. |
|
Does
your company perform habitat modification? |
|
Pruning
shrubs away from the house (foundation planting) to reduce insect
entry to homes; installation of bat houses. |
|
Do you
use any physical or mechanical controls? |
|
We
use a device called a weed hound to extract broadleaf weeds from the
earth. |
|
What
type of fertilizers do you use/sell/recommend? |
|
Composted
poultry manure, fish emulsion, seaweed, compost teas, green sand,
iron, gypsum, sulfur, corn gluten. |
